    Too much demand is better if you are coming from a purely capitalistic stand point. But, I personally believe little demand is sometimes much better because it gives you a chance to expand with the customers that you have. You can still make a lot of money without necessarily having to increase demand. Take care of people and they will take care of you. The more customers you end up having not only stretches your resources but it takes away from the quality you can deliver yourself.
